On Thu, 2008-04-24 at 19:47 -0700, Henry Yei wrote:
> Hello,
> 
> This patch removes the dependency of existing tty* devices for this test
> to pass, and also ups the invalid file descriptor value from 400 to 1025
> which is used to confirm the EBADF errno.

But i get a testcase failure after applying the Patch. Please see below
the results:

<<<test_start>>>
tag=sockioctl01 stime=1209151071
cmdline="sockioctl01"
contacts=""
analysis=exit
initiation_status="ok"
<<<test_output>>>
incrementing stop
sockioctl01    1  PASS  :  bad file descriptor successful
sockioctl01    0  WARN  :  tst_rmdir(): TESTDIR was NULL; no removal
attempted
sockioctl01    2  FAIL  :  not a socket ; returned -1 (expected -1),
errno 25 (expected 22)
sockioctl01    3  PASS  :  invalid option buffer successful
sockioctl01    4  PASS  :  ATMARK on UDP successful
sockioctl01    5  PASS  :  SIOCGIFCONF successful
sockioctl01    6  PASS  :  SIOCGIFFLAGS successful
sockioctl01    7  PASS  :  SIOCGIFFLAGS with invalid ifr successful
sockioctl01    8  PASS  :  SIOCSIFFLAGS with invalid ifr successful
<<<execution_status>>>
duration=0 termination_type=exited termination_id=5 corefile=no
cutime=0 cstime=0
<<<test_end>>>

$ uname -a
Linux <sniff> 2.6.18-53.1.13.el5 #1 SMP Mon Feb 11 13:27:52 EST 2008
i686 i686 i386 GNU/Linux

Test Executes fine pre-patch. It would be nice if you can share your
test results pre and post-patch.
